Yvonne, the wife of Jo Davidson, was a fashion desginer. She founded a Parisian couture house that catered to a rich Franco-American clientele. In memory of his wife, who died in 1934, Jo Davidson sculpted this bas-relief which represents her carrying one of her models. (Source: Dossier of Musée des Beaux-Arts, Tours)
